Sign In — Free (10 views/day)MARINE MACHINERY ASSOCIATION, founded in 1984, is a small nonprofit that reported $371K in total revenue in fiscal year 2020. Revenue decreased 13% compared to the prior year.
MMA is responsible for collecting and disseminating legislative regulatory contractual information relating to the manufacturing and supplying of naval machinery and equipment.
